“Disturbing.” CT Senate GOP Statement on Arrests of Nurse Impersonator & Her Employer
January 16, 2026
Sen. Stephen Harding, Sen. Jeff Gordon, Sen. Henri Martin, Sen. Eric Berthel and Sen. Rob Sampson today issued the following statement with regard to the arrest of a Connecticut woman who was allegedly impersonating a licensed nurse and performing unauthorized procedures as well as the arrest of a woman who owned the staffing agency that hired her.
